Wildlife at Jenolan Caves

We reached Jenolan caves in late afternoon, and were so awed by our one-hour tour of Chifley Cave that we decided to stay overnight and visit another cave the next day. In the evening, we walked over to Blue Lake, a small, dam-created body of water just outside the main entrance to the cave complex. I had overheard someone say you could see platypus in the lake, and that turned out to be true. I’m told that platypus are ordinarily very shy, but this one must be accustomed to tourists. The evening chorus of birds and insects was delightful, I captured that, knowing that not much of what I was seeing would be visible in the video.
